Market Fluctuations
Market fluctuations, an ever-present reality in real estate, can make even the savviest investors wary. The Dubai real estate market, while robust, has its share of ebbs and flows. For instance, property values may rise sharply in boom periods, only to correct themselves during downturns. Such volatility requires investors to remain vigilant. To mitigate risks, it's advisable to conduct thorough market analyses, closely monitor real estate trends, and stay updated on local events that could impact housing prices.
Investors must consider:
- Supply and Demand Dynamics: An influx of new developments can saturate the market. If the supply surpasses demand, it could lead to declining property values.
- Economic Indicators: Macro-economic factors such as employment rates, interest rates, and GDP growth can affect buyer confidence.
- Seasonal Trends: Dubai often experiences seasonal fluctuations due to tourist influx, which can temporarily boost demand but might not be sustainable long-term.
"Real estate isnāt just about property; itās about timing the waves of the market."
Staying ahead means being prepared not just for current trends but also anticipating possible shift in buyer sentiment as demographics change.
Regulatory Environment
The regulatory landscape plays a crucial role in shaping the real estate market. In Dubai, regulations are continuously evolving, impacting everything from property ownership rules to zoning laws. For expatriates, understanding these rules is especially important. For instance, there are freehold areas where foreigners can own properties outright, while other areas may have different restrictions.
Some aspects investors should pay attention to include:
- Property Ownership Regulations: Different laws for expatriates versus local citizens can complicate investment strategies. Familiarize yourself with legal stipulations to avoid pitfalls.
- Monitoring Changes: Policies can change quickly. Keeping up with local governance news can inform better decisions. Relevant platforms such as government websites and real estate forums are valuable resources.
- Financing Options: The legal framework surrounding mortgages and loans may not be uniform. Knowing which lenders allow for favorable terms can save potential headaches down the line.
